Who is a Dentist and What Do They Do?
A dentist is a healthcare professional who specializes in the diagnosis, prevention, and treatment of diseases and conditions of the oral cavity. They play a crucial role in maintaining the health of your teeth, gums, and jaw.

Qualifications of a Dentist in India
In India, an experienced dentist in Jaipur, Rajasthan typically holds the following degrees:
BDS (Bachelor of Dental Surgery): The foundational 5-year degree required to practice dentistry.
MDS (Master of Dental Surgery): A postgraduate specialization (3 years) in areas such as Orthodontics (braces), Endodontics (root canals), or Oral Surgery.
Registration: All practicing dentists must be registered with the Dental Council of India (DCI).
Do Dentists Perform Surgeries?
Yes, many dentists are trained to perform surgical procedures. While a general dentist handles minor surgeries like simple tooth extractions, specialized Top dentists in Jaipur, Rajasthan (Oral and Maxillofacial Surgeons) perform complex procedures, including:
Dental Implants: Surgically placing metal posts into the jawbone.
Wisdom Tooth Extractions: Removing impacted teeth.
Corrective Jaw Surgery: To treat skeletal misalignments.
Gum Surgery: For treating advanced periodontal disease.
When Should You Consult a Dentist?
You shouldn't wait for a toothache to search for a "dental clinic in Jaipur, Rajasthan." Regular visits every six months are recommended. However, book an appointment immediately if you experience:
Persistent Pain: Sharp or dull aching in teeth or jaw.
Gum Issues: Bleeding while brushing, swelling, or redness.
Sensitivity: Extreme reaction to hot or cold food and drinks.
Mouth Sores: Any ulcer or sore that doesn't heal within two weeks.
Structural Damage: Chipped, cracked, or loose teeth.
Cosmetic Concerns: Stained teeth or gaps that affect your confidence.

Q1. Does professional teeth cleaning (scaling) make my teeth loose?
Ans. No, this is a common myth. Scaling removes harmful tartar (calculus) that causes gum disease. Removing this buildup actually strengthens your gums and prevents your teeth from becoming loose in the long run.

Q4. At what age should I take my child for their first dental visit?
Ans. The general rule is "First visit by first birthday." As soon as the first tooth appears, or by age one, a child should see a dentist in Jaipur, Rajasthan. Early visits help children get comfortable with the clinic environment and allow the dentist to monitor proper jaw development.
